15516300143 has 2 divisors, whose sum is σ = 15516300144. Its totient is φ = 15516300142.

The previous prime is 15516300113. The next prime is 15516300187. The reversal of 15516300143 is 34100361551.

It is a weak prime.

It is a cyclic number.

It is not a de Polignac number, because 15516300143 - 210 = 15516299119 is a prime.

It is a congruent number.

It is not a weakly prime, because it can be changed into another prime (15516300113) by changing a digit.

It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 7758150071 + 7758150072.

It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(7758150072).

Almost surely, 215516300143 is an apocalyptic number.

15516300143 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(1).

15516300143 is an equidigital number, since it uses as much as digits as its factorization.

15516300143 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.

The product of its (nonzero) digits is 5400, while the sum is 29.

Adding to 15516300143 its reverse (34100361551), we get a palindrome (49616661694).
